How to enter 1099-DIV when the FEIN is 00-000000

On my 1099-DIV, the FEIN is listed as 00-000000.  This has been the same way for as long as I can remember.  In past years, TurboTax had a check box that said that the FEIN was not provided, and allowed me to enter the form without it.  This year, that option is not available and will not allow me to enter that form.  If I leave it off it says "Needs info" and if I enter 00-000000 like it is on the 1099-DIV, it says it is an invalid FEIN.  What do I do?
